What are the biggest changes in ACA subsidies this year?
Recent exchanges reflect updated income thresholds and enhanced premium tax credits, shrinking out-of-pocket costs for millions. Users with incomes between 100–400% of the federal poverty level may qualify for richer assistance—details that significantly impact monthly budgets.
Can I stay enrolled outside open enrollment?
Yes—qualifying life events (job loss, marriage, birth) trigger special enrollment periods. Missing this window risks coverage gaps, but knowing when exceptions apply prevents costly surprises.
Does the ACA still protect me from being denied coverage?
Absolutely. The law prohibits denial based on health status, though coverage scope and network size vary by plan. Understanding these limits helps users evaluate options strategically.

What People Often Get Wrong About the ACA
Myths circulate in fast-moving digital spaces, and awareness here is crucial. The guide corrects:
Myth: ACA plans are all the same.
Fact: Bronze, silver, gold, and platinum plans vary in premiums, deductibles, and provider networks—choices that affect real coverage quality.
Myth: Medicaid covers everyone.
Fact: Eligibility thresholds differ by state; some adults remain uncovered due to coverage gaps or income limits.
Myth: Premium tax credits cover all costs.
Fact: They reduce out-of-pocket expenses but don’t eliminate deductibles or coinsurance—transparency here prevents budget shocks.
